Repairing Cooling Issues
When your fridge isn't cooling correctly, it can lead to ruined food and lost cash, so addressing the concern promptly is critical. Begin by checking the temperature level settings to confirm they're at the advised levels, typically around 37 ° F for the fridge and 0 ° F for the freezer. If the setups are appropriate, inspect the door seals for any spaces or damage; a malfunctioning seal can allow warm air to enter.
Next, check out the vents inside the refrigerator and freezer. Validate they're not obstructed by food items, as this can interrupt airflow. Listen for the compressor; if it's not running or making uncommon noises, it may require focus. Inspect the condenser coils, usually located at the back or base of the device. Dust and particles can gather, causing cooling concerns. Clean them with a vacuum cleaner or brush to maximize efficiency. If issues persist, it might be time to call an expert.

Determine Leakage Sources
Just how can you properly identify the resources of water leak and ice build-up in your home appliances? Begin by evaluating the seals and gaskets on your refrigerator and fridge freezer doors. A used or broken seal can allow cozy air to go into, causing condensation and ice. Next off, check the drainpipe frying pan and drainage system for obstructions or clogs; a backed-up drain can result in water pooling. Try to find any Check Out Your URL type of loose connections in the supply of water line, which can develop leakages. Check out the defrost drainpipe for ice accumulation, which can interfere with appropriate water drainage. By methodically examining these areas, you'll identify the resource of the issue, permitting you to take the necessary steps to fix it and extend your device's life expectancy.
